District Overview
The Excel Center of West Central Indiana is a newly established independent charter district situated at 2702 S. 3rd St. in the small city setting of Terre Haute, Indiana. Operating a single specialized school as its own local education agency for federal programs, this public district is dedicated to high school education, serving students across grades 9 through 12. Positioned within the broader Terre Haute metropolitan area, the district offers a tailored academic environment designed to open new educational pathways and help local learners achieve their secondary credentials.
During the 2024–2025 academic year, the district served a total student body of 139 learners, with the vast majority embarking on their foundational high school coursework, including 103 ninth-grade and 30 tenth-grade students, alongside a smaller cohort of upperclassmen. The student population represents a diverse cross-section of the local community, comprising 89 White students, 31 Hispanic students, 16 Black students, and three multiracial students, with an almost even gender distribution of 73 female and 66 male students. To ensure a highly supportive learning environment, the district relies on a dedicated team of 14 full-time equivalent staff members, including 11 support personnel and three instructional aides who assist students in reaching their academic and personal goals.
